在终端中打印花式文本的实用程序。

roma-console的Python项目详细描述


控制台

这个软件包提供了打印文本所需的工具(具有花哨的样式 (如有规定)。 要使用,请通过导入Console类的实例

fromconsoleimportconsole

风格奇特的文本

花哨的文本是基于termcolor包生成的。 此包的用法类似于termcolor

^{pr2}$

但是,console提供了另一种基于简单语法打印文本的方法, 更灵活、更强大:

console.write_line('#{Hello}{red} #{World}{blue}{bold}!')

这里的语法是#{<text>}[{<text_color>}][<text_highlight>}][{<attributes_1>}]...[{<attributes_N>}]。在

其他奇特用法的例子:

console.split('#{-}{red}#{-}{yellow}#{-}{blue}')

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java不兼容类型:MainActivity无法转换为LifecycleOwner   java安卓是一种更有效的读取大文本文件的方法   java导出LWJGL本地人与项目?(IntelliJ IDEA)   JDK更新后,JavaJShell不再在下一行打印输出   父类对象上的继承Java比较子属性   Java:有没有一个容器可以有效地结合HashMap和ArrayList?   安卓 Java对象指针   java在annotationdriven Spring MVC应用程序中实现大气   java 安卓源代码构建应用找不到安卓supportv4。罐子   文件系统上的抽象层和Java中的jar/zip   java在水平滚动视图中添加多个图像?   java如何从firebase实时数据库中获取字符串数组   WIndows 10工作站上的java未满足链接错误   java命令在终端中工作,但在使用过程中出现“无结束引号”错误。执行官